What is Gold Dollar James Garfield worth?

The 2011 James Garfield dollar coins in circulated condition are only worth their face value of $1.00. These coins only sell for a premium in uncirculated condition. Both the 2011 P James Garfield dollar coin and 2011 D James Garfield dollar coin are each worth around $11 in uncirculated condition with an MS 65 grade.

How much is a 1881 gold dollar coin worth?

USA Coin Book Estimated Value of 1881 Large Indian Head Gold Dollar is Worth $332 in Average Condition and can be Worth $678 to $1,364 or more in Uncirculated (MS+) Mint Condition. Proof Coins can be Worth $6,550 or more. Click here to Learn How to use Coin Price Charts.

What is the most valuable gold dollar coin?

One of the last gold coins ever struck for circulation in the US sold for a record $18.9 million in New York on Tuesday. The exceptionally rare 1933 "Double Eagle" is now the most valuable coin ever to appear at auction, almost doubling the previous world record, according to Sotheby's, which organized the sale.

What penny is worth $1000000?

Top 10 Things You Didn't Know About the Penny

The first 1943 copper cent was sold in 1958 for more than $40,000. In 1996, another went for a whopping $82,500. But those sales pale in comparison with the latest: this week, a dealer in New Jersey sold his 1943 penny for a staggering $1.7 million.

How many president gold dollars are there?

From 2007 to 2016, the Mint issued four Presidential $1 Coins per year, each with a common reverse design featuring a striking rendition of the Statue of Liberty. The composition of the Presidential $1 Coins is identical to that of the Sacagawea Golden Dollar and the Native American $1 Coins.

How much is an 1886 $5 gold piece?

1886 S Half Eagle Value

According to the NGC Price Guide, as of May 2022, a Half Eagle from 1886 in circulated condition is worth between $550 and $635. However, on the open market 1886 S 5 Dollar Coins in pristine, uncirculated condition sell for as much as $13000.
